Fair to disagree. But, I feel that you have a narrow and inaccurate definition of nepotism.
Nepotism is any privilege granted to relatives or friends. It can range from securing a job interview to offering the job on a platter. So access isn't something completely different from nepotism but one form it takes.
There is no doubt Vicky Kaushal is talented, hardworking, and deserving of every ounce of success he has. But by definition, he is a product of nepotism. And dozens of people in the movies get jobs due to nepotism - makeup artists, hairdressers, set designers, and more.
This is why I will continue to maintain - people aren't against nepotism per se. If nepotism grants small favors or obscure jobs, no one cares. It is only the glitz and glamor of lead roles that people are up in arms about.

Vicky Koushal and his brother are nepo babies for sure. Anybody who has father, mother or older brother or sister working in the industry is a nepo baby.
As far VK's father is concerned he is not well known outside industry because he is part of the backend crew. For a movie only the director producer music composer and singers and actors are headlined, the backend technical crew doesn't get highlighted. Like Ajay Devgan's father Veeru Devgan VK's dad is quite well connected and influential in the industry.
However everyone including Karan Johar is not an idiot to cast anyone simply because they are children of Industry person
Nepo babies get role on the basis of their saleability to distributors. Which itself is based on the popularity / visibility in media of that nepo baby.
The actors are the face of a movie, their visibility is a marketing expense. When a producer casts Jahnvi he knows that she will pull in media for interviews and promotions as she is Sridevi's daughter. His own expense on marketing the movie to distributors and media is reduced. Whereas Vicky Koushal before he married Katrina would require a big expense in marketing the movie.
Specially in tier II and tier 3 cities distributors prefer nepo babies to cash in on their parents star value. I remember a discussion with a friend on Abhishek Bachchan when he had just started. My Friend's uncle owned a theatre in Bhopal. Arjun Rampal was trying to make his name the same time as Abhishek and the uncle made the statement that "Amitabh's son would get in enough crowd to pay for electricity even if the movie is thrid rate, so I pay the price distributor asks" but if I have to screen Arjun Rampal movie I only buy it at the cheapest possible price as unless the movie is very good and word of mouth is positive I will not make money.
Movie making is a business end of the day
Access would be someone like Bhumi Pednekar who was working as assistant casting director before she got an acting role. Or Aishwarya Rai / Sushmita Sen and other Miss India's due to their beauty pageant win. John Abraham would be another example of access. Shahrukh was example of access, not outsider. His theatre mentors connected him to Aziz Mirza who then connected him to Vivek vaswani and who connected him to Aditya Chopra who connected him to Karan Johar.
If for eg Manish Malhotra has a son who gets casted by KJo it would again be a nepo baby situation because Manish Malhotra is an insider
Difference between Nepo Baby, Access person and Outsider is very simple.
For a Nepo Baby they can land at a producer/director's home and have lunch with them while pitching themselves for the role
For an access person they can make a phone call to office and get appointments with the producer and director directly to pitch themselves for the role
Outsiders have no direct way of contacting producer and directors till they have a sufficient number of hit films.
We have eg of Ayushman Khurana when he couldn't reach Kjo at all till he became successful.
Whether they get the role or not simply is based on their saleability and not their ability to act. Good actors have to acquire their saleability by giving their own multiple hit films, nepo babies bring it due to their parents hit films
